Hiking around Trasaghis offers diverse landscapes at the eastern edge of the Carnic Prealps, bordered by the Tagliamento River. The region is characterized by mountain scenery, pristine waters, and valleys, including the picturesque Val del Lago. Natural features like Lake Cornino and its reserve provide a scenic backdrop for outdoor activities. The varied terrain includes both gentle paths around lakes and more challenging mountain trails.

The climb to the summit of Monte Brancot offers an experience rich in history and nature, with the ruins of the castle and the small church of San Michele along the way. The vegetation changes with the altitude, and the final stretch offers breathtaking views. A non-technical but challenging excursion, best enjoyed in cooler seasons.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many hiking trails are available around Trasaghis?

Trasaghis offers a wide variety of hiking experiences with over 50 routes available. These trails cater to different preferences, from gentle lakeside strolls to challenging mountain ascents within the Carnic Prealps.

Are there hiking trails for all skill levels in Trasaghis?

Yes, Trasaghis provides options for every hiker. You'll find 10 easy routes perfect for a relaxed outing, 35 moderate trails for those seeking a bit more challenge, and 13 difficult routes for experienced hikers looking for significant elevation gains and longer distances.

What kind of natural features can I expect to see while hiking in Trasaghis?

The region is rich in natural beauty, characterized by the eastern edge of the Carnic Prealps and the Tagliamento River. Hikers can explore picturesque valleys like Val del Lago, serene waters such as Lake Cornino, and discover features like the Butines Waterfalls or the dramatic Arzino Valley gorge.

Are there any circular hiking routes in Trasaghis?

Yes, many trails in Trasaghis are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end at the same point. A popular example is the Lake Cavazzo Loop Trail, which offers scenic views around the lake, or the more challenging Monte Cuar Loop Trail with panoramic viewpoints.

Are there any challenging long-distance hikes in the Trasaghis area?

Yes, for experienced hikers seeking a challenge, Trasaghis offers demanding routes. The Mount Tre Corni and Palantaris Loop from Braulins is a difficult 14.2 km trail with significant elevation gain, often taking over 8 hours to complete. Another challenging option is the Trail 840 through Rio Cuvii pools and Leale River Gorge.

What is the best time of year to go hiking in Trasaghis?

Trasaghis offers hiking opportunities throughout much of the year. Spring and autumn generally provide pleasant temperatures and vibrant scenery, with spring showcasing blooming flora and autumn displaying rich fall colors. Summer is also popular, especially for higher altitude trails, but can be warm in the valleys. Winter hiking is possible, particularly on lower elevation trails, but requires appropriate gear for colder conditions.
